Functional mobility preservation is the clinical objective of maintaining the necessary range of motion, muscle strength, balance, and coordination required for independent execution of daily activities and participation in physical exercise throughout the lifespan. This preservation is a direct measure of musculoskeletal and neurological health, extending beyond simple physical fitness to encompass the sustained capacity for quality of life. It requires the continuous maintenance of bone mineral density, joint integrity, and neuromuscular efficiency. The ability to perform complex movements without pain or limitation is the hallmark of success.
Origin
This term is derived from geriatrics, physical therapy, and longevity medicine, focusing on the sustained ability to function independently. ‘Functional’ refers to utility in daily life, and ‘mobility’ encompasses movement and locomotion, while ‘preservation’ denotes the active maintenance against age-related decline. The goal is to counteract sarcopenia and dynapenia, the age-related loss of muscle mass and strength.
Mechanism
Preservation is strongly linked to anabolic hormonal signaling, particularly the actions of growth hormone (GH), IGF-1, and testosterone, which promote muscle protein synthesis and maintain connective tissue health. The mechanism also involves optimal neurological input, ensuring efficient motor unit recruitment and proprioceptive feedback. Regular physical loading provides the necessary mechanical stimulus to maintain bone and muscle tissue, thereby ensuring the structural integrity required for sustained mobility.
